Posts - Bill - HR 1222 Operation Lone Star Reimbursement Act

house 02/11/2025 - 119th Congress

We are advocating for the Operation Lone Star Reimbursement Act to ensure that the State of Texas is reimbursed for its significant expenditure in securing the southern border, efforts that have contributed to enhancing safety across the nation. This proposed legislation acknowledges Texas' proactive measures against issues like human trafficking and drug proliferation and seeks federal support for the expenses incurred.
